1959 AC Greyhound vs. 2005 Toyota Windom
To start off, 2005 Toyota Windom is newer by 46 year(s). Which means there will be less support and parts availability for 1959 AC Greyhound. In addition, the cost of maintenance, including insurance, on 1959 AC Greyhound would be higher. At 2,993 cc (6 cylinders), 2005 Toyota Windom is equipped with a bigger engine. In terms of performance, 2005 Toyota Windom (212 HP @ 5800 RPM) has 89 more horse power than 1959 AC Greyhound. (123 HP @ 5750 RPM) In normal driving conditions, 2005 Toyota Windom should accelerate faster than 1959 AC Greyhound. With that said, vehicle weight also plays an important factor in acceleration. 2005 Toyota Windom weights approximately 515 kg more than 1959 AC Greyhound. So despite on having greater horse power, its additional weight may have an impact towards its acceleration in comparison.
Let's talk about torque, 2005 Toyota Windom (294 Nm @ 4400 RPM) has 115 more torque (in Nm) than 1959 AC Greyhound. (179 Nm @ 4500 RPM). This means 2005 Toyota Windom will have an easier job in driving up hills or pulling heavy equipment than 1959 AC Greyhound.
